A MOA is a MOA is a MOA. Both MOA and mill are angular measurements. A MOA is a minute of angle. A MOA is 1/60 of a degree. A mil is 1/1000 of a radian.
But both of them equal a certain LINEAR measurement at each given range. And that linear measurement increases linearly with range.
A mil is 10 cm at 100 meters. It is 20 cm at 200 meters, and 100 cm at 1000 meters.
And BTW, a true MOA is 1.047" at 100 yards.

Let say you're shooting at an antelope at 300 yards. You are six inches high (not MOA but six inches) You have 1 MOA clicks, You have to come down 6 inches. One MOA is 3.141 inches per click at 300 yards (3 X 1.047 = 3.141). I need to come down 6 inches. So I come down two MOA Clicks. 2 X 3 is 6, and 2 X 3.141 is 6.282. So talking antelope, I'm going to be .282 inches below the center of the 8.5-9 inch vital (heart lung) area.

An animal is the same size regardless of the units used to measure it. You are confusing linear measurements with angular ones. It's as easy to 'come up' in Mils as it is in MOA, and maybe easier because there are fewer actual adjustments.Animals are inches tall, not MOA or MILs, but constant inches.
